Satvik Sureshkumar

2×2 · top 31.5% of 186,767 all-time · competing since October 2016 · 2016SURE03

Satvik Sureshkumar has been competing for 10 years. His best event is the 2×2: a personal-best single of 4.39, set at Pune Cube Open 2018, puts him in the top 31.5% of the 186,767 people who have ever been ranked in the event, and 2,796th in India. Across 2 competitions since October 2016, he has put 21 official solves on the record across three events. His 3×3 best has come down from 51.23 in October 2016 to 21.25, a 59% improvement.
